THE ORGANIZATION

The Center for Justice Innovation is a nonprofit organization dedicated to advancing community safety and racial justice. Since 1996, we’ve worked alongside communities, courts, and those most directly affected by the justice system to build stronger, healthier, and more equitable neighborhoods. With a team of over 900 staff and an annual budget of $130 million, the Center carries out its mission through three core strategies:

  • Operating Programs that pilot new ideas and address local challenges;
  • Conducting original research to evaluate what works—and what doesn’t; and
  • Providing expert assistance and policy guidance to reformers across the country and beyond

Backed by decades of on-the-ground experience and nationally recognized expertise, we bring innovative, practical, and lasting solutions to justice systems nationwide.

THE OPPORTUNITY

The Center is seeking an experienced Contracts Coordinator to join our Contracts Operations Team to support the administration and oversight of the Center’s end-to-end contracting process. Reporting to the Contracts Manager, the Contracts Coordinator will assist with managing the revenue contracting process to ensure the timely execution, ongoing review, and reporting of all the Center’s revenue generating grants and contracts. The Contracts Coordinator will also assist with managing the expense contracting process to ensure the timely review, approval, and execution of all the Center’s expense contracts.

Responsibilities include but are not limited to:

Project Management and Communication:

  • Support the Contracts Manager with contracts management, ensuring strong communication, coordination, and timely execution of tasks across all departments involved for both revenue and expense contracts;
  • Act as a point of contact for all contracts and grants related inquiries and facilitate effective communication between Program Operations and Administrative functions; and
  • Provide timely updates and reports on the progress, challenges, and outcomes of contracts and grants management projects to stakeholders

Liaison and Collaboration:

  • Foster effective collaboration between Program Operations and Administrative functions, promoting a cohesive and efficient contracts and grants management process;
  • Collaborate with departments such as Legal, Finance, Development, People, and Technology to ensure smooth coordination and alignment in contracts and grants-related activities; and
  • Contribute to the facilitation of cross-functional meetings and serve as a liaison to address and resolve issues that arise during the contracts and grants management processes

Contracts Management Meetings:

  • Assist with organizing and running monthly contracts management meetings for each "Project Portfolio" involving Grant Management, Program Operations, Development, Finance, Legal, and other relevant stakeholders;
  • Develop meeting agendas, collect and distribute pre-meeting materials, and document action steps and decisions made during meetings; and
  • Provide project management support to ensure the timely execution of action items for contracts and grants and address any challenges or issues that may arise

Contract Submissions:

  • Review funder contracting guidelines, deadlines, and gather required documents and forms (e.g., insurance forms, work scopes, budgets, etc.);
  • Secure appropriate signatures from the Center's Executives and Board of Directors;
  • Submit contract packages to appropriate agencies and/or other funder organizations and individuals via online platforms, mail, e-mail, or in person;
  • Work with funder contract managers to address any questions;
  • Update funder compliance forms and systems as needed; and
  • Additional tasks and projects as necessary.

Qualifications: Bachelor's degree and at least 3-5 years of experience in the field of finance, business management, or non-profit administration to apply. Candidates with lived experience are encouraged to apply. Candidates should be Notary Publics and have experience with non-profit organizations. Excellent written skills are a must. The candidate must be a skilled communicator and be able to work in multi-disciplinary setting, maintaining strong relationships with multiple agencies and organizations, both onsite and in the community. The candidate should have experience working with government grants and contracts, has high energy and curiosity about the Center’s work, and a talent for project management. The candidate should have strong interpersonal communication skills, exceptional organizational and time management skills, experience as a change maker, and an aptitude for technology.

Position Type: Full-time.

Position Location: Midtown Manhattan, hybrid schedule working on site 2 days per week with potential travel within the five boroughs to other sites.

Compensation: The compensation range for this position is $62,300 - $77,200 and is commensurate with experience.
